The SHOWA CHM Chem Master Neoprene Chemical Glove is a flexible chemical-resistant glove designed for industrial workers who handle chemicals, wet parts, oily parts, cleaning solutions, coatings, and maintenance materials in automotive, chemical, food processing, janitorial, painting, and manufacturing environments.
Built with neoprene-over-natural-rubber construction, the SHOWA CHM provides a chemical-resistant barrier while maintaining flexibility, sensitivity, and comfort for extended work. The unsupported glove design includes a cotton flock liner that helps keep the hand comfortable during long shifts, while the tractor-tread embossed grip helps fluids run off the glove surface for better handling control in wet or slippery conditions.
The SHOWA CHM is rated CAT III and listed with EN ISO 374-1:2016 Type A chemical protection code AKLMNT, EN ISO 374-5:2016 microorganism protection, and EN 388:2016+A1:2018 2021X mechanical performance. It is also listed for food contact, making it useful for food processing and sanitation teams that need chemical-resistant hand protection for washdown, cleaning, and handling tasks.

Safety Note
Chemical-resistant gloves must be selected based on the specific chemical, concentration, exposure time, temperature, task, degradation, and permeation data. EN 374 Type A does not mean the glove is suitable for every chemical or every exposure condition. Review the chemical Safety Data Sheet and SHOWA chemical resistance data before use. Inspect gloves before each use and replace them if torn, punctured, swollen, stiffened, degraded, or contaminated beyond your facility’s reuse policy.

Buying Guide: Neoprene Chemical Gloves vs. Nitrile Chemical Gloves
Choose SHOWA CHM neoprene-over-natural-rubber gloves when workers need flexibility, wet grip, flock-lined comfort, and chemical resistance for cleaning, chemical treatment, coating preparation, and wet or oily handling tasks.
Choose nitrile chemical gloves when the chemical compatibility data shows nitrile is a better match for the specific oil, grease, fuel, solvent, or chemical exposure. Neither neoprene nor nitrile should be treated as universal chemical protection. Always match glove material to the chemical, concentration, contact time, and task.
For cut hazards, consider a chemical-resistant cut glove. For extended chemical immersion or aggressive chemical exposure, review higher-protection chemical glove options and manufacturer permeation data.

What does AKLMNT mean?
AKLMNT identifies the tested chemicals under EN ISO 374-1. It does not mean the glove works for every chemical. Always check chemical compatibility data for the exact chemical and exposure conditions.
Is this glove food contact approved?
SHOWA lists the CHM with food contact certification. Food facilities should still follow their sanitation and glove-use procedures.
Is this glove latex free?
Do not treat it as latex-free without documentation. SHOWA describes the glove as neoprene over natural rubber, so latex-sensitive users should verify suitability before use.
